Cayuga/Taughannock 3/8

Reports

Got out on Cayuga to check on northerns and lakers. The pike I found were still in winter patterns and not very aggressive – though it was midday and somewhat bright out. H2O on the lake is 37. Water level is very low – good for shoreline casters.

I spent around 1+1/2 hours lake trout fishing. Fishing was surprisingly good! I was impressed with the aggressiveness of these winter lakers. I landed 5 nice fish in little over an hour. They ran from 23″ to over 27″. I kept 3 and they all had alewives in their stomachs. So they are starting to feed and there’s some bait around. Most fish were around 100′ to 110′. I worked the King Ferry/Millican area.
